The Cost of an iPhone Charging Port Replacement
The cost of replacing an iPhone charging port can vary greatly depending on the model, type of repair, and location. Generally speaking, third-party shops offer a more affordable option, with prices ranging from $45 to $199, depending on the iPhone model. On the other hand, Apple's authorized service providers charge between $149 and $249 for a replacement.

The Average Charging Port Replacement Cost for Different iPhone Models
Here's a rough breakdown of the average charging port replacement costs for various iPhone models:
- iPhone 8:$79-$159
- iPhone XR:$89-$159
- iPhone 11:$99-$149
- iPhone 13 Pro:$129-$179
- iPhone 14 Pro Max:$149-$199

Preventing Future Issues
Preventing charging port problems in the first place is always better than dealing with a costly repair. Here are some tips to keep your charging port in top condition:
- Clean your charging port regularly: dirt and dust can interfere with the charging process.
- Use quality cables: high-quality cables can prevent wear and tear on the charging port.
